In the story, Darcy bakes some brownies for Riley and he finds them really good. It turns out that Darcy uses the recipe of her aunt with a secret ingredient: Tea. As soon as I read this, I wanted to try it! So I took my favourite brownie recipe and added 1 tablespoon of my favourite tea, Chai. The result was really tasty and I could totally taste the tea. 

Ingredients:
- 75 g butter
- 150 g dark chocolate
- 130 g sugar
- 2 eggs
- 65 g flour
- 1 tbsp tea

1) Preheat oven to 180º C. Cut the chocolate and melt it with the butter. 
2) Once it's melted, add the sugar and the eggs and mix. And then add the flour and the tea.

3) Bake for around 35 minutes and done! Tip: I actually could taste the tea better once the brownie had cooled, so have a little patience!
